Oppenheimer & Co’s Clearway Energy Class C CWEN Stock Holding History

Bought
Maintained
Sold
Quarter Market Value Status Shares Shares
Change %
Capital Flow Portfolio Weight Portfolio Position
2025
Q2
$349K Sell
10,902
-1,481
-12% -$47.4K ﹤0.01% 1287
2025
Q1
$375K Buy
12,383
+62
+0.5% +$1.88K 0.01% 1182
2024
Q4
$320K Buy
12,321
+1,599
+15% +$41.6K ﹤0.01% 1234
2024
Q3
$329K Buy
10,722
+1,260
+13% +$38.7K 0.01% 1189
2024
Q2
$234K Buy
+9,462
New +$234K ﹤0.01% 1287
2023
Q3
Sell
-17,598
Closed -$503K 1391
2023
Q2
$503K Buy
17,598
+111
+0.6% +$3.17K 0.01% 970
2023
Q1
$548K Sell
17,487
-1,555
-8% -$48.7K 0.01% 907
2022
Q4
$607K Buy
19,042
+600
+3% +$19.1K 0.01% 857
2022
Q3
$587K Buy
18,442
+51
+0.3% +$1.62K 0.01% 833
2022
Q2
$641K Buy
18,391
+1,823
+11% +$63.5K 0.01% 833
2022
Q1
$605K Buy
+16,568
New +$605K 0.01% 930
2019
Q1
Sell
-15,846
Closed -$273K 1355
2018
Q4
$273K Hold
15,846
0.01% 979
2018
Q3
$305K Sell
15,846
-795
-5% -$15.3K 0.01% 1064
2018
Q2
$286K Sell
16,641
-5,740
-26% -$98.7K 0.01% 1075
2018
Q1
$380K Buy
22,381
+2,971
+15% +$50.4K 0.01% 957
2017
Q4
$367K Sell
19,410
-4,285
-18% -$81K 0.01% 978
2017
Q3
$457K Sell
23,695
-1,149
-5% -$22.2K 0.01% 873
2017
Q2
$437K Buy
+24,844
New +$437K 0.01% 884
2015
Q3
Sell
-9,151
Closed -$200K 1370
2015
Q2
$200K Buy
+9,151
New +$200K 0.01% 1303